Output 159524977d3b5ecb7a40775bf86980155385b6c895966ea67af7357e82ad2396:14

value
30000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02810a0b66830cdbcc1cbb25f94d9db331ced61e99ca9295f052f58e4bfd7485
address
tb1pq2qs5zmxsvxdhnquhvjljnvakvcua4s7n89f990s2t6cujlawjzsnad62g
transaction
159524977d3b5ecb7a40775bf86980155385b6c895966ea67af7357e82ad2396
confirmations
22399
spent
true